Double-Glass Photovoltaic Panels: Wattage per Side and Performance Insights

Let's cut through the technical jargon. A standard double-glass photovoltaic panel typically delivers 360-600 watts per side depending on configuration . But wait, no – that's the combined output. The front side usually generates 85-90% of total power, with the backside contributing 10-15% through reflected light .
